Sakura is not confident in her singing ability (HYBE LABELS YT Screenshot)


On July 29, 2024, LE SSERAFIM released a documentary titled “Make It Looks Easy” which aired on HYBE’s official YouTube channel.


The documentary provides an in-depth look into their journey from their final stage rehearsal in 2022 to preparations for the release of their third mini album, “EASY”.


In the video, Sakura is seen very emotional and crying in an interview, revealing her fear of public speaking.


She expressed deep fear about her choice to become an idol and felt very doubtful about the decision.


“I don’t know why I chose to become an idol. Is this really a job that I can do well?” Sakura said with doubt.


She admitted that every time she made a mistake on stage or felt limited, she felt like there was someone else who was more worthy of being an idol.


Although she feels very passionate and happy with her job, Sakura still doubts her own abilities. "I often felt that maybe I didn't have the talent or ability to continue in this job," she explained.


She further explained, "When I hear various opinions and criticisms, I feel very confused and wonder why I am still doing this job while crying so hard."


Despite experiencing emotional difficulties, Sakura still returned to the practice room with strong determination and big dreams.


She is determined to be able to surprise people and believes that even if she doesn't succeed in achieving all her goals, having big dreams and trying hard is a blessing in itself.


The documentary clearly captures the worries and emotions that idols experience, providing an in-depth look into their lives that are often hidden behind the scenes.


In addition to Sakura, the other members of LE SSERAFIM also share their struggles and dreams, showing that they are growing not only as entertainers but also as sincere artists.


Recently, LE SSERAFIM came under the spotlight for their live performances which were considered to lack vocal skills. It all came to a head when they took the Coachella stage in April, sparking controversy and criticism./kpopchart.com
